Assembly No. 21
Evolution of T1 (1955-1959)
The Transporter reached its fifth year of production with reforms in many aspects, which made it more practical, useful and versatile. Thus, the foundations of an authentic legend that would consolidate during the following decade were already established.

Assembly No.27
The other T1 Camper
In addition to Westphalia, other manufacturers also offered their own conversions of the T1 for lovers of camping. The popularization of camping in the United States made the demand for this type of vehicles soar and offered a good business opportunity to a large number of entrepreneurs.

Assembly No. 28
Evolution of T1 (1959-1962)
The Transporter entered the new decade maintaining the basic characteristics that had made it a success during its first ten years of life. To them, Volkswagen added a large number of technical improvements that ensured the commercial validity of the T1 for several years, in a process of continuous improvement, a method comparable to what was already being applied in the Bug

Assembly No. 29
The Caddy
The name Caddy has been used by Volkswagen to name several of its commercial models over more than thirty years. Although they were vehicles of very different conception among them, they all had in common their great versatility.
